Nobody actually likes a handmaid's tale. As an examination of a dystopian society it fails to deliver in world building and the characters are one-dimensional and uninteresting. It's as if they're props not to elevate the main character (which is what you would usually expect from a bad writer), but to elevate the underlying political message. It's a lazy political pamphlet, masquerading as a social critique the likes of 1984 or Brave New World, by borrowing the dystopian setting, without ever really going into the horror of the society portrayed. Reading the book I couldnt help but think, that nothing in that book hasnt already been done years ago somewhere. Nothing gripped my 17 year old self back when I read it like other dystopian novels did.
